Indiana Statutes
§ 32-21-5-6 — "Owner" defined
Indiana·Title 32 PROPERTY·Art. 21 CONVEYANCE PROCEDURES FOR REAL·Ch. 5 Residential Real Estate Sales Disclosure
As used in this chapter, "owner" means the
owner of residential real estate that is for sale, exchange, lease with an
option to buy, or sale under an installment contract.
[Pre-2002 Recodification Citation: 24-4.6-2-6.]
